TECHNICAL CHANGES These models are compatible with the outdoor units with low standby power control. Connecting these models to the MUZ-AY·VG series outdoor units enables the low standby power control. These models may be connected to the MUZ-AY·VG series after once connected to the MXZ series and operated, for example because of relocation.

8-5. CHANGING THE CORRECTION VALUE OF THE ROOM TEMPERATURE (THE INLET TEMPERATURE) The correction value of the room temperature can be adjusted in the range of 2 to 5 °C with the remote controller. Normally, the temperature at the room temperature sensor might become higher than that around feet because warm air tends to accumulate around an indoor unit during heating operation.

(5) STOP (operation OFF) and ON TIMER standby In the following cases, the horizontal vane returns to the closed position. (a) When Off/On(stop/operate) button is pressed (POWER OFF). (b) When the operation is stopped by the emergency operation. (c) When ON TIMER is ON standby. (6) Dew prevention During COOL or DRY operation with the vane angle at Angle 4 or 5 when the compressor cumulative operation time exceeds 1 hour, the vane angle automatically changes to Angle 1 for dew prevention.

TROUBLESHOOTING MSZ-AY15VG MSZ-AY15VGK MSZ-AY15VGKP MSZ-AY20VG MSZ-AY20VGK MSZ-AY20VGKP 10-1. CAUTIONS ON TROUBLESHOOTING 1. Before troubleshooting, check the following 1) Check the power supply voltage. 2) Check the indoor/outdoor connecting wire for miswiring. 2. Take care of the following during servicing 1) Before servicing the air conditioner, be sure to turn OFF the main unit first with the remote controller, and then after confirming the horizontal vane is closed, turn OFF the breaker and/or disconnect the power plug.
